Types of Sensitive Information Sensitive regulated information requiring notification Sensitive regulated information not requiring notification Sensitive information
Sensitive Regulated Information Requiring Notification Personal Information Requiring Notification • Social Security # • Credit Card # • Financial Account # • Driver’s License # Notification required ifthere was a potentialfor unauthorized use! Inform Information Security Team
Sensitive Regulated Information Not Requiring Notification • HIPAA (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act) • Information related to health status, provision of health care, or payment of health care • FMLA • Information related to Family & Medical Leave Act • FERPA • Student records Inform HR Information Security Team
Sensitive Information Date of birth Home address Salary information Performance/disciplinary information Other? Inform HR Information Security Team
